Ask Alys: your gardening queries answered

After a period of home renovation during which our garden went to seed, our arbutus now has nettles growing through its base, the branches look burned and stressed, and the leaves have a rust problem. What can I do? Competition from the hungry nettles may have stressed your strawberry tree ( Arbutus unedo ), making it vulnerable to attack from pathogens. It may have arbutus leaf spot, which can cause both leaves and twigs to die – this starts as purplish spots with a yellow or green centre, then eventually the leaves turn yellow and fall off. Some form of root rot may also be to blame: this causes leaves to yellow and fall off, with no new growth. Weeding out the nettles may be fiddly, because arbutus dislikes root disturbance: if necessary just cut them back until they give up. Bin infected leaves and twigs (do not add them to the compost). Mulch with well-rotted horse manure or homemade compost to feed the plant and save moisture. It may pull back, but if it looks the same next year, consider a new plant. • Got a question for Alys?
